问题标签 [windows-phone-7.1.1]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
visual-studio-2010 - 有评级控制,windows phone 7
windows phone 有分级控制吗?类似于 silver-light 工具包中存在的控件,我知道 silverlight 中没有控件,或者我必须自己自定义控件?我正在使用 Windows Phone 7.1、C#、Visual Studio 2010
datacontext - Windows Phone 7.1 应用程序退出而不抛出任何异常
目前正在开发一个多线程的 WP 7.1.1 应用程序,并且有一半以上的时间应用程序在“初始阶段”退出而没有抛出任何异常。它只是以所有线程返回 0x0 并且没有输入任何 Closing/Exit/Quit 事件结束。
“初始阶段”究竟是什么意思?我使用“Windows Phone 性能分析”对应用程序进行了概要分析,并结合了一些调试消息和一些日志记录,我估计它大约在启动后 3-4 秒。此时,GUI 已经在很短的时间内可见。
我几乎可以肯定问题是由于以下调用而发生的:
为了防止 DataContext 出现任何多线程问题,每次调用都会创建一个新上下文:
我什至尝试了 BackgroundWorker 和 ThreadPool 而不是 Async CTP 3,但效果相同。我知道以前曾多次问过非常相似的问题,但我根本找不到任何解决方案来解决我的问题。有什么方法/程序可以找到导致异常的确切方法(原因,位置)?可以创建多少个线程是否有任何限制?可以以这种方式安全地使用 DataContext 吗?
非常感谢您的帮助。
windows-phone-7.1.1 - 视频播放的tapjoy问题
我有一个使用 Silverlight 构建的 Windows 手机游戏。在这个游戏中,我想添加 TapJoy。我已经下载了他们最新的 SDK 并按照他们的所有步骤在我的应用程序中集成它。
在游戏中,我使用silverlight作为主框架和Global Media Element来播放连续的背景音乐。我正在使用 (Microsoft.Xna.Framework.Media) (Microsoft.Xna.Framework) 命名空间。使用它们,我使用以下方法来播放连续的背景声音。DispatcherTimer 和 FrameworkDispatcher.Update
现在,当我点击点击欢乐按钮打开他们的优惠时,他们加载正常;但是,当我在优惠中打开视频时,他们向我们显示以下错误“视频无法播放,请重试。”</p>
基于一些研究和研究,我尝试了一些事情,发现,a)我需要将 Media Element 和 DispatcherTimer 设置为空。b)应用程序在后台发送(停用),然后我再次打开它(激活),视频很好。我检查并发现 Media Element 和 DispatcherTimer 已正确设置为 null。
但是,如果我只执行第一步,并且不在后台发送应用程序,则媒体元素和 dispatcherTimer 不会设置为 null。
谁能帮助我并在下面回答我
a) 我在为此做任何事情吗?b)我可以做任何事情,以便当点击欢乐按钮时,我的应用程序会自动发送到后台,因为这可以解决问题。c)我在将值设置为 null 后使用 gc.collect() 但它仍然没有被破坏。
在此先感谢大卫雅各布。
windows-phone-7.1 - 检测 wp7 sdk 和特定组件的存在
有没有办法以编程方式检测 Windows Phone 7 SDK(版本 7.0、7.1 和/或 7.11)和特定组件(如模拟器、模拟器版本、模拟器映像版本、程序集等)的存在。
我希望通过一个简单的 .NET 4 控制台应用程序来做到这一点。如何判断机器使用的 WP7 SDK 版本?有一点信息,但似乎不够完整。
谢谢
windows-8 - Windows Phone SDK 7.1.1 更新在 Windows 8 Release Preview 上冻结
我无法安装 WinPhone 7 SDK 更新 v7.1.1。每次我尝试安装时它都会冻结我的计算机,鼠标仍然可以工作,但一段时间后整个系统锁定,我需要按住电源按钮将其关闭。查看任务管理器并在配置模拟器时看起来像冻结。尝试了几次,甚至重新安装 Windows 仍然没有运气。有人知道解决这个问题吗?我看到其他一些人面临这个问题,但没有解决方案。
windows-phone-7 - 指南针 - 根据纬度和经度显示方向
在 WP7 中,是否可以根据给定的纬度和经度值显示指南针方向。(例如,如果我在印度并且如果给出了其他国家/地区某个地方的纬度和经度值)。如果是,请就如何实现这一目标提供一些想法。
wpf - 访问在祖先资源中定义的 DataTemplate
我正在尝试访问其子级中派生抽象类(来自PhoneApplicationPage)的资源。这是一个更具体的例子:
父 WPF
子 WPF
由于 DataTemplate 的性质 - 包含点击事件 - 我无法将其移动到应用程序资源中。虽然理论上这会起作用。
附带说明:有趣的是,我无法在父构造函数或子构造函数中访问资源。
有任何想法吗?
c# - 突出显示 wp7 ListBox 的中间 UserControl 项的详细信息,如图所示
我有一个水平列表框,其中包含用户控件(150 宽度和 150 高度作为尺寸)作为项目。
我一次在列表框中显示 3 个项目。我的问题是如何在滚动时检测中间项目,以便当我向左或向右滚动时,我可以在放置在其上方的 texblock 中显示中间列表框项目的名称和其他详细信息。
请参考上传的图片。
提前致谢。
windows-phone-7 - 使用 MVVM 从 ListBox 中删除项目
我正在尝试从 ListBox 中删除一个项目。该命令已正确触发,并且该项目已从数据库中正确删除,但未刷新列表。
这是视图模型。我正在使用 MVVM Light 4.1
谢谢您的帮助。
PS:我知道有类似的问题,但没有一个被接受的答案对我有用:(
编辑 1 这是我在 XAML 页面中用于将 ListBox 绑定到项目列表的代码:
这是 ViewModel 到主容器的绑定
编辑 2 这是 ViewModel 的完整代码
windows-phone-7 - 如何在 Windows Phone 中更新辅助磁贴的导航 URI
我有一个应用程序可以根据用户的选择在开始屏幕上创建辅助磁贴。辅助磁贴打开一个文档。有一个要求是,每当重命名文档时,与其关联的磁贴(如果存在),也必须更新其导航 uri,以便辅助磁贴始终指向同一文档。
但我无法做到这一点。我看到的唯一方法是删除并重新创建磁贴。这实际上没有用(因为它导航到开始屏幕)。我只想在内部做。但是,ShellTile.Update
方法对我来说似乎没有用。
请帮忙。任何帮助将不胜感激。提前感谢